The NWSL season is officially here, and we spent most of this episode getting you ready for it.This week:​She Believes Cup is a wrap: USWNT takes their 8th title, but real questions remain at left back, the nine position, and playing without a true six.​Complete NWSL history, current season teams & players to watch: From the WUSA's $100M collapse to a $2.5 billion league today, we dig into the history, finances, players to watch, and our title picks heading into Season 14.​Unrivaled Season 2 closes strong: Mist BC wins the championship over Phantom BC, Brianna Stewart takes MVP honors, and the league posts 66% year-over-year revenue growth to $45M.​WNBA CBA deadline hits: Offers have been bouncing back and forth with nothing resolved as of taping. Let's hope there's good news by the time this airs!Plus:StubHub launches Her Sports Hub with data showing 215% post-Olympics ticket purchase growth, Team USA Women's Basketball tips off World Cup qualifying in Puerto Rico with Caitlin Clark and crew, a chaotic NCAA conference tournament weekend, the Boston Fleet and New York Sirens heading to TD Garden and MSG, Oksana Masters winning her 20th Paralympic medal, and the Women's Africa Cup of Nations postponed just two weeks before it was supposed to start.Instagram/Threads/YouTube: @rtg_podEmail: [email protected]
